What

They say that we resist change, but isn't it more about resisting being changed?


When the world feels confusing, heavy and uncertain, it can be easy to put our own lives on hold - waiting for things to change back to how they were, before allowing ourselves to feel joy, peace, or inspiration again. This meditation explores how we can hold two realities at once: caring deeply about what is going on in the world, while still allowing ourselves to experience the beauty and joy that also exists at the same time.


Nature reminds us that life continues to unfold in many layers, at once. A storm may be raging above the surface while a fish continues swimming peacefully below. The rain may be falling heavily, while flowers are blooming. Circumstances can be difficult to take in while simultaneously, beautiful things are still happening.
